The Zero-Trust Imperative

One of the most pressing challenges for IT leaders today is cybersecurity, particularly as mission-critical workloads migrate to the cloud. We are tackling this head-on with Intel by focusing on confidential computing. Our joint work is designed to encrypt “data in use,” protecting it not just at the application level but also at the underlying system level. This is a crucial component of a “zero trust infrastructure,” a security framework that assumes no one‌ — ‌inside or outside the network‌ — ‌can be trusted without verification.
